Output 1f9b8dc02fcaecccd3d805fa53c46ba896e58cfc8e63ee26dd63c7b91ae262fe:0

value
688743315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a330e09c1596d9398d4b4346b152f320efbc0c2 OP_EQUAL
address
3Cq9XJK3abhxAjwVzXhNh7ZDAr1ZMCkFKT
transaction
1f9b8dc02fcaecccd3d805fa53c46ba896e58cfc8e63ee26dd63c7b91ae262fe
confirmations
388359
spent
true